MM 1 K M ins ( i Tmi aaMTaun omhnv. von city. A Queer l'lay In ltiiaehull. Here Is a play in haschull that liav pelted -long a;o. Perhaps it never will Impjien apiln. lld any one ever bear of a base runner scoring from tlrst luise on a line drive that was caught by a third baseman and when the hall never left the third baseinan's baud? Tlie play happenis! In this way: Andy Moynlliun was jilayliiK third base for the Pastimes of Chicago In tSUS when a tournament was held. The Oecldeu talu of Peoria were tlie opjKisliijj team In tlie tlrst IiuiIuk. with a runner on first, the batter drove a liner straight over third. Moynlhan shoved up his bund, thu ball struck it nnd stuck fast In thu hand. The crowd cheered. An Instant later they buw something was wrong. Moynllian, writhing w ith pain, wns running around third base. Tlie base runner nt first saw something was tlio emitter and ran down to second. Then lie ran to third and dually trotted homo unmolested. Tlio trouble was that the ball, strik ing Moynlliun's hand, paralyzed tlio nerves. The bull was stuck tight In tils hand. It was five minutes before his fellow players could pry his Angers open nnd get tho ball out. Chicago Tribune. Slonl t'tiihtera. A very pretty effect may be produced by using some nnlllne dye In powdered form In alcohol. Fill a small glass with tho alcohol and drop the smallest Iortlon of tlio dye on Its surface. It will shoot down through tlie liquid, llko a strand of color, dividing Into two branches, which will subdivide ngaln and ngaln until you have, niiparently, an Inverted plant In miniature growing before your eyes. An arruiigemeiit of mirrors may be made to throw tho re flection of this on n screen or n wall, and tho enlarged shadows will be very Interesting to watch.
